Falmouth - and The Lizard Peninsula

Falmouth has arguably the most beautiful natural setting of any town in Cornwall, but remains within an hours drive of all parts of the Duchy: including The Eden Project, St. Ives and St. Michael's Mount.

Located on the western banks of the beautiful Falmouth estuary, Falmouth is 'naturally' famous for its maritime heritage, and the new National Maritime Museum Cornwall.

Falmouth caters for a wide range of visitor interests from museums; indoor swimming at the Ships and Castles leisure pool - complete with fantastic wave machine; water sports of every description; listening to the variety of concerts regularly performed in the Princess Pavilion or just plain relaxing on the beautiful main sandy beaches close by.

Both the town centre and harbour are within easy walking distance and each provide plenty of interest and activity. We are ideally situated for ferries, fishing trips, scenic walks and the beautiful Gyllingvase, Maenporth and Swanpool beaches.

There is a water-skiing and windsurfing centre nearby, as well as indoor swimming pools, tennis, golf and of course sailing - since Carrick Roads and clear waters around Falmouth Bay offer some of the finest sailing and underwater diving in the country.

A short drive away you can visit the Lizard Peninsula; or visit tourist attractions such as Flambards theme park; Goonhilly Earth Station; Gweek Seal Sanctuary; and many more of interest. The surrounding areas offer some of the most beautiful gardens in Cornwall including Trebah; Trelissick; Glendurgan; and if going further afield, you will find The Eden Project and The Lost Gardens of Heligan.
